ABB Composite Insulators – Design for reliable performance (1HSM954308 03en)


In the event of an internal fault/ inner over pressure or external influence/ vandalism a porcelain insulator will show a violent failure (explosion) with dangerous fragments dashed around at high speed. The failure mode of a composite insulator is delamination/ puncture without launching of destructive fragments. There is no damage of surrounding equipment and no danger for persons in the vicinity. This gives maximum safety for both personnel and substation. ABB produces hollow composite insulators by extruding silicone rubber sheds on to a composite tube using a patented helical extrusion process. These well-established manufacturing practices and improved material properties ensure reliable service over the life of ones electrical apparatus. ABB Composite Insulators with silicone rubber sheds offer many advantages over traditional ceramics: •Improved safety for personnel and equipment •Superior pollution performance due to hydrophobic surface condition •Excellent seismic performance •Low weight •Short delivery times •Flexible design ABB Composite Insulators are normally used in: •Circuit Breakers •Bushings •Instrument Transformers •Cable Terminations ABB is currently providing hollow composite insulators in the voltage range 72 kV 800 kV and in lengths up to 10m. All composite insulators are tested and certified according to IEC 61462.
